Sugar

  • Processed into all kinds of foods we eat.
  • Absorbed into the bloodstream faster due to high glycemic index rating.
  • High blood-sugar levels put stress on the human body leading to the body becoming less sensitive to insulin.
  • Consumption leads to diabetes, coronary disease and prevents the absorption of calcium and magnesium into the body.
  • WHO recommends adults and children to reduce their daily sugar intake to less than 10% of their total energy intake.
  • 1 teaspoon of sugar contains 20 calories.

Sweeteners

  • Derived from molecules like aspartame, sucralose & steviol glycoside. Sweeteners provide food with sweetness and negligible calories.
  • Ingredients found in sweeteners are widely used and safe for consumption.
  • Appropriate for table top consumption as well as cooking and baking.
  • Ideal for weight watchers & calorie conscious.
